


Giro d'Italia Men Highlights
Stage 17
Season 2025 Episode 17
Action from the 17th stage of the Giro d'Italia
Giro d'Italia Men Highlights airs on TNT Sports 1 at 6:00 AM, Thursday 29 May.
Topics
Sports
Action from the 17th stage of the Giro d'Italia